The hexadecimal color code #540E7E corresponds to the code RGB( 84, 14, 126 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,33 level), green (at 0,05 level) and blue (at 0,49 level). Its brightness is 27% and its saturation is 80%. It is composed of red at 37%, green at 6% and blue at 56%.
